In addition to myotics, mydriatics are also recommended. Most commonly used:
- 1% solution of atropine sulfate, the effect of which can last approximately one week;
- preparations "Midriacil" and "Tropicamide". Their effect is short-lived - about a couple of hours.
The action of mydriatics depends on the tonus of the muscle that narrows the pupil. The condition of the parasympathetic and sympathetic nervous system also plays a role.
